- TATHAGAT KUMARAug 12, 2024 · a year agoWhen it comes to minimizing tax liability in the highest tax bracket, cryptocurrency investors in Canada have a few options. One strategy is to utilize tax-loss harvesting. This involves selling investments that have experienced losses to offset capital gains from other investments. Another approach is to consider donating appreciated cryptocurrencies to charity. By doing so, you can potentially eliminate capital gains tax and receive a tax deduction for the fair market value of the donated assets. Additionally, it's important to keep detailed records of all your transactions and consult with a tax professional who specializes in cryptocurrency taxation to ensure compliance with the latest regulations.
